Do this before replacing the pump!
I thought I needed a new power steering pump until I watched a few YouTube videos that suggested replacing the O rings and reservoir instead. Boy! They were spot on. The whole process took less than an hour and make sure to use a vehicle specific synthetic fluid (in my case, Honda).
